The Congree Toolbar

The Congree Toolbar gives you quick and easy access to the functions and settings of the Congree Authoring Client (see Settings).

Note:

The grayed-out buttons only become active after logging in to the Congree Server and activating Congree.

  1. Log in/Log out button: Click to connect to the Congree Server or to terminate an existing connection.
  2. Turn on/Turn off button: Click to turn the Congree functions off or back on.
  3. Drop-down list Rule set: Select a document-specific rule set for your current session. If you have configured a default rule set in the Settings, this rule set will be preselected.
  4. Document button: Start the check of the entire document.
  5. Section button: Start the check of the selected section.
  6. Settings button: Configure the settings for the Congree Authoring Client.
  7. Info button: See the version of the installed Congree Authoring Client.
  8. Help button: Click to call up your internal online help. To use this functionality, the respective URL must be stored in the Congree Control Center.
